Divisional Overview:

 

Powai LCC broadly covers the areas of Legal, Compliance and Conduct, and is responsible for building a robust risk and control framework. The Powai LCC teams support Nomura Powai entities, as well as LCC teams globally to ensure effective risk management of Legal, Compliance and Conduct related risks for the firm. Powai Legal comprises of the Corporate Legal and Transaction Legal functions, which provide advice and support on corporate, employment and transactional matters. The Offshore Legal team supports global teams on corporate and secretarial matters, Global Markets, and Masters documentation related requirements. Powai Compliance comprises of functions such as Core Compliance, Trade Surveillance, Electronic Communication Surveillance, Financial Crime Monitoring, Control Room & Disclosure Monitoring and Central Compliance. The teams provide advisory and operations support to global / regional Compliance teams driven by global / regional policies and regulatory expectations.

 

Business Unit Overview:

 

Central Compliance team provides support to Nomura entities globally on Training & Affirmations, Policies Management, Licensing & Registrations, Regulatory Change & Reporting and Infrastructure Advisory functions. Team ensures Nomura staffs abide by the policies and procedures in place to meet applicable compliance requirements and regulatory obligations. The Central Compliance team supports onshore entities in providing guidance and oversight of staff on key Compliance matters. Team assists regions on monitoring, identification, and management of risks as Second Line of Defence for the firm.

Role & Responsibilities:

 

 

  • Core Functions
    • Manage end-to-end Compliance Training programs and Learning Management System administration
    • Oversee Compliance Policy Affirmations/Attestation program, ensuring timely completion by employees
    • Coordinate with global teams to maintain smooth Training and Affirmation processes
  • Project and Stakeholder Management
    • Prioritize workload according to team objectives and Global Compliance Training Manager requirements
    • Manage multiple deadlines effectively
    • Liaise with internal/external stakeholders and vendors to ensure seamless process execution
    • Prepare and deliver accurate Management Information (MI) reports to stakeholders
  • Training Course Development and Quality Assurance
    • Conduct comprehensive course testing to ensure full functionality
    • Troubleshoot and escalate technical issues as needed
    • Support course development through storyboarding, design, and implementation
    • Identify and implement process improvements to enhance efficiency
  • Risk Management
    • Monitor, identify and escalate potential risks within the process
    • Escalate concerns to local and regional management as appropriate
    • Maintain compliance standards throughout all processes

This role requires strong attention to detail, excellent project management skills, and the ability to work effectively with diverse stakeholders across global teams.
